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 210919 - kde-base/kde-meta-4.0.1 should have nls USE flag
Summary: kde-base/kde-meta-4.0.1 should have nls USE flag
Status: RESOLVED WONTFIX
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: [OLD] KDE (show other bugs)
Hardware: All Linux
: High enhancement (vote)
Assignee: Gentoo KDE team
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2008-02-20 21:22 UTC by Michael Schachtebeck
Modified: 2008-02-21 08:30 UTC (History)
1 user (show)

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Michael Schachtebeck 2008-02-20 21:22:09 UTC
kde-base/kde-meta-3.5.8 has a USE flag "nls". If enabled, kde-base/kde-i18n is pulled in as a dependency. kde-base/kde-meta-4.0.1 does not have such a USE flag that pulls in kde-base/kde-i10n - it would be nice if this could be added to the ebuild

Reproducible: Always

Steps to Reproduce:
Comment 1 Wulf Krueger (RETIRED) gentoo-dev 2008-02-20 22:58:23 UTC
Sorry, but we won't introduce it again. USE flags for optional runtime stuff don't really make sense.

Nevertheless, please give my best regards to good old Georgia Augusta which is where I studied, too. :-)
Comment 2 Michael Schachtebeck 2008-02-21 07:40:21 UTC
Hmm, what a pitty - I found it very useful to once tell my system that I want to use available localizations (setting the global USE flag nls) instead of manually emerging localizations for every single package which provides one (and manually checking if it does). :-(

You've studied in Göttingen, too? It's a small world!
Comment 3 Michael 2008-02-21 08:30:16 UTC
I have the same opinion as "Michael Schachtebeck". There should be a global mechanism which automatically installs available localliztions. It is unacceptable to let the user do the whole investigation if an extra package provides a localization for other packages.

I installed KDE 4 and wondered why there is no german translation. I looked at kde.org but there they said german translation is completed. I searched the forums but nowhere was a hint. The old kde-18n was still a 3.5.x release and I thought that KDE 4 is to new at gentoo for localizations. A thread, which I posted, gave me the answer that the package is now called kde-10n.

You see it is too much work if you simply want to install translations, which nearly everyone want to have installed.
But if you still don't want to introduce the flag, then add a hint output for this to the meta-package so noone have to to the same as I had to do.